Summer Series Instructor
Pyramid Hill Sculpture Park & Museum is seeking fun and professional artists and art educations to expand and diversify our teaching roster for our 2022 Summer Series workshops.
Each workshop will be planned around a distinct theme suitable for students of varying ages and skill levels and will include projects/activities that can be completed over the course of the one-hour workshop. Summer Series Instructors are responsible for coordinating projects and activities for campers, giving instruction during workshops to both campers and parents, and providing direction to volunteers who provide support with Summer Series activities.
